Hi Ramesh,
I assume you are going for the MCSE on Data Management and Analytics?
To become a MCSE on Data Management and Analytics you will need do have one of the following MCSAs + 1 MCSE exam(which in this case you already have):
- MCSA: SQL Server 2012/2014
- MCSA: SQL 2016 Database Administration
- MCSA: SQL 2016 Database Development
- MCSA: SQL 2016 BI Development
- MCSA: Machine Learning
- MCSA: BI Reporting
- MCSA: Data Engineering with Azure

Hi,
For the MCSA: SQL Server 2012/2014 you will need to pass all of those exams: 70-461, 70-462 and 70-463.(So you will need to pass 3 exams to become a MCSE)
For the MCSA: SQL 2016 Database Administration its 70-764 and 70-765.(Here you need pass 2 exams to become a MCSE)
You might want to check your certification planner, it will tell you all the paths/exams you can take to achieve the MCSE. Other exams may qualify for a shorter path.MCSAs are in general two or three exams and you don't need to have a lower level certification to get it.
MCSE is one exam but they require a specific MCSA.Regards
